Two gas cylinders contain ethylene (ethene) and acetylene respectively. One test which can be used to distinguish between them is by?
-
A.
passing each gas through bromine water
-
B.
passing each gas through dilute potassium permanganate solution
-
C.
passing each gas through silver nitrate solution
-
D.
treating each gas catalytically with excess hydrogen gas
Correct Answer: Option C
Explanation
Acetylene reacts with ammoniacal AgNO3 solution to form a white precipitate of silver acetylide (AgC-=Cag) but ethylene does not
